WebProline originates from glutamic acid, the carboxy reduced to an aldehyde, amino group attacking to form the Schiff base, and further reduction. Basically, the N is from the original alpha-amino group. Proline qualifies as nonpolar and cyclic. As for tryptophan, it has an indole substituent on the beta-carbon. WebProline is unique among the standard amino acids in that it does not have both free α-amino and free α-carboxyl groups. WebProline differs from other amino acids in that its side chain and α-amino N form a rigid, five-membered ring structure . Proline, then, has a secondary amino group. -referred to as an "imino acid."

WebDec 4, 2024 · The amino acid L -proline is considered to be nonessential because humans and other animals can biosynthesize it, mainly from another nonessential amino acid L -glutamic acid. Proline is unusual in that it is heterocyclic, and thus is the only natural amino acid that contains a secondary amine group. Only the L -enantiomer is found in nature. WebFeb 28, 2024 · Structurally, proline (Figure 6) is unique among the AAs because its side chain loops around and reconnects with the peptide backbone. All the other AAs have primary amines, and when bound in a polypeptide chain, they become secondary amides; Pro within the chain becomes a tertiary amide.

Amino acid replacement is a change from one amino acid to a different amino acid in a protein due to point mutation in the corresponding DNA sequence.
